I'm really enjoying the pieces I have made recently--I've been using more beads and doing a triple crochet chain for heavier, less precise pieces.  It was a bit of luck, this process; I just wanted to use up my beads faster than I had been due to a certain...um...shopping spree on ebay's bead section.  I have a slight neurosis when it comes to making sure that my beads all fit tidily in the same little box.  Too many beads for said box means time to use up beads.

 

I've also been working on a new ring process that I think is very jolly.  The ring shank and foundational nest are all made from the same piece of silver, so you don't get the pricks, pinches, and re-sizing that is the usual hallmark of handmade rings.  I would wear them and I don't wear fanciful rings, really.
